Acne is not transmitted between persons, including from parents to their children. There are familial tendencies, and it is possible your kids will be at higher risk. But with modern medical care, almost nobody ever needs to suffer with severe acne, or to develop scarring. When you have kids, discuss with their pediatrician; and maybe with a dermatologist at first signs of expected teenage acne.
